    Abstract: Several embodiments of a die for heat sealing a heat sealable carton having a gable shaped closure are disclosed. Each embodiment of the die includes a pair of opposed jaws. Each of the jaws has portions for providing a firm seal capable of keeping bacteria out of the carton, and other portions for selectively sealing non-critical areas of the carton to a lesser extent to make the carton easy to open. The lightly sealed areas are caused by a recessed area in at least one jaw; a protrusion associated with a recessed area provides a highly staked seal area. A method of packaging in gable top cartons is also disclosed.

    Abstract: A method and apparatus for storing a plurality of tires having a threaded portion, a rim portion and two sidewall portions, said method comprising the following steps; peripherally slicing each of said tires in two half tires along said threaded portion about midway between said sidewall portions; performing radial incisions in each of said two half tires, said incisions extending through said threaded portion and part of said sidewall portion; stacking up said half tires one on top of the other in order to form a pile of half tires; compressing said pile longitudinally in order to flatten said half tires one over the other; whereby, said radial incisions allow the threaded portion of each half tire to lie in the same plane as the sidewalls of the same half tire without warping when said half tire is compressed into a flattened condition.

    Abstract: Containers for beverages are rotated about their own axes and are simultaneously transported past a water applying sponge and thereupon past an applicator of labels which completely surround the peripheral surfaces of the respective containers so that the leader of each label is overlapped by its trailing end. The films of water which are applied by the sponge reduce the likelihood of slippage of labels relative to the peripheral surfaces during draping of the labels, and such films evaporate when the application of labels is completed so that the labels surround but do not adhere to the containers. The trailing ends of the labels are coated with adhesive which bonds them to the respective leaders.

    Abstract: The lean premix combustion approach for NOx emissions control in gas turbine combustion systems has led to the problems of increased combustion pressure oscillation during engine operation and flame outs during rapid engine load reduction. Combustion pressure oscillation can reduce the durability of the engine and combustion system components to unacceptable levels. Flame outs can make the engine unacceptable from the operational viewpoint. The use of a control device allows the combustion pressure oscillation amplitude to be controlled to levels required for long durability of the combustion system components. It also allows an engine control system to operate the engine at part load condition and during rapid load reduction without flame out. When used at small levels, its effect on the engine NOx emissions is small. Higher levels may sometimes be needed to control the combustion pressure oscillation to acceptable levels.

    Abstract: A process is disclosed for the purification of natural gas in which the reduction of the nitrogen content of a natural gas stream is achieved by a combination of absorption, purification, flashing, and reflux steps. More specifically, the process achieves the rejection of inert components such as nitrogen from hydrocarbon gas streams without operating in the cryogenic temperature range. The process uses a lean solvent to absorb the non-rejected components in a recovery zone of an absorber and uses a cooled light gas stream to purify the rich solvent in a purification zone of the absorber. The process can be employed to reject hydrogen and recover C.sub.3 +hydrocarbons from a dehydrogenation reaction zone integrated with an etherification zone for the production of ethers to improve recovery and lower operating costs.

    Abstract: There are provided low profile inductor and transformer windings, and methods for fabricating the same. An elongate conductive ribbon is wound in one continuous direction on a generally hourglass shaped mandrel to form the ribbon into a double conical helix having a plurality of spaced apart coils. A sheet of dielectric material having an orifice therethrough is threaded to the midpoint of the double conical helix. The two sides of the helix are then compressed into planes such that the coils in each side lie flat and engage the adjacent side of the sheet of dielectric material. A compound inductor winding can be fabricated from a continuous conductive ribbon wound into a plurality of double conical helixes joined end-to-end. After compression, the compound winding consists of a low profile stack of spiraled windings connected in series, but constituting only one continuous ribbon having no internal connections.

    Abstract: Erythrocytes exist in vivo in a continuous cell subset gradient of density, with the youngest cells being the lightest. A blood sample is centrifuged in a transparent tube containing plastic beads which are selected to include groups of beads wherein each group has a different sharply defined specific gravity, and which are distributed within the range of red cell densities. The beads form spaced well-defined bands in the erythrocyte layer, which bands form boundaries between the different cell subset layers. Measurements of the lengths of the different cell subset layers are then made to quantify the red cell subsets in the patient's blood.

    Abstract: An integrated tip strain sensor is combination with a single axis atomic force microscope (AFM) for determining the profile of a surface in three dimensions. A cantilever beam carries an integrated tip stem on which is deposited a piezoelectric film strain sensor. A high-resolution direct electron beam (e-beam) deposition process is used to grow a sharp tip onto the silicon (Si) cantilever structure. The direct e-beam deposition process permits the controllable fabrication of high-aspect ratio, nanometer-scale tip structures. A piezoelectric jacket with four superimposed elements is deposited on the tip stem. The piezoelectric sensors function in a plane perpendicular to that of a probe in the AFM; that is, any tip contact with the linewidth surface will cause tip deflection with a corresponding proportional electrical signal output. This tip strain sensor, coupled to a standard single axis AFM tip, allows for three-dimensional metrology with a much simpler approach while avoiding catastrophic tip "crashes".

    Abstract: The absolute angular position of an internal combustion engine is determined by monitoring engine intake manifold pressure at a strategic position in the manifold affected most significantly by the intake event of a predetermined cylinder. A significant or maximum depression in manifold pressure over each engine cycle then is indicative of the intake stroke of the predetermined cylinder.
